Insurers want to avoid risk. Clearly some people near you have claimed for flood-related incidents, and/or their postcode/based map shows the area as increasing risk of flooding (maybe local newbuilds on former soakaway land upstream, whatever), so they don't want the risk. Try another insurer or ask how much it would be if you remove flooding from the policy?0
